bonce

[ bons ]

nounBritish Slang.
  1. head; skull: I was nearly blinded by the light reflecting off his freshly shaved, bloody great bonce.

Origin of bonce

1
First recorded in 1885–90; origin unknown

British Dictionary definitions for bonce

bonce

/ (bɒns) /


noun
  1. British slang the head

Origin of bonce

1
C19 (originally: a type of large playing marble): of unknown origin
